GitHub’s Security Breach: A Closer Look
In a surprising revelation, GitHub announced a breach impacting 3,800 repositories. This event has sent shockwaves through the developer community, highlighting the fragile nature of digital security.
- Immediate Response: GitHub acted swiftly, notifying affected users and securing compromised repositories.
- Vulnerability Exploited: Initial investigations point to a flaw in the authentication process.
- Impact on Projects: Several high-profile projects faced setbacks due to compromised codebases.
- Community Reaction: Developers worldwide are urging for increased security measures.
- Lessons Learned: The breach underscores the need for robust security protocols.
- Future Safeguards: GitHub promises to enhance its security infrastructure.
Understanding the Breach Mechanics
The breach exploited a vulnerability within GitHub’s authentication mechanism, allowing unauthorized access to repositories. This highlights a critical gap in security that calls for immediate attention and remediation.

Building a Secure Future
As the dust settles, the focus shifts to preventing future breaches. The GitHub incident serves as a critical learning point for developers worldwide.
- Enhanced Authentication: Implementing multi-factor authentication as a standard.
- Regular Audits: Conducting frequent security audits to identify potential vulnerabilities.
- Developer Education: Training developers on best practices to bolster code security.
- Stronger Encryption: Ensuring all data is encrypted to prevent unauthorized access.
- Community Collaboration: Encouraging open dialogue to share security insights.
- Continuous Monitoring: Utilizing AI and machine learning to detect anomalies swiftly.
Real-World Examples of Security Success
Some organizations have already implemented robust security measures, resulting in reduced vulnerability to breaches. These examples provide a blueprint for others to follow.
Best Practices for Repository Security
Adopting a proactive approach to security can mitigate risks. Developers are encouraged to regularly update credentials, review permissions, and monitor repository activity.
